JSM classic scopes are unavailable during credential creation for API/service account scopes

      Issue Summary

      While creating scoped access using API scopes or a service account, we can choose classic/granular scopes. 

      While all the Jira cloud classic scopes are available, all classic scopes related to JSM, as mentioned in JSM-specific Classic scopes  are missing. 

      We will have to go through 100s of granular scopes to find JSM-specific granular scopes or asset related scopes

      Steps to Reproduce

      1. Try creating a service account credential or an API token with scopes. 
      2. While searching for App scope, only Jira Confluence and Atlassian is listed. 
      3. If we select Jira, only Jira classic scopes are visible: 

      Expected Results

      • JSM classic scopes should be visible. 
      • We should be able to filter scopes based on product (App) for JSM and Assets. 

      Actual Results

      There is no product differentiation, and classic scopes are missing. We need to search through all granular scopes to create a service account for JSM use. 

      Workaround

      Currently there is no known workaround for this behaviour. Customer will have to add related Granular scopes one by one. With a limit of 50 scopes customer will run out of scopes for a single API token.
